Warriors Lacrosse Charge into the Season

Boys Lax gets ready for season, and opened on high note. They look to add more excitement the rest of the way. Photo courtesy Mckie Etheridge.

Steinbrenner boys lacrosse opened up their regular season on February 12th, 2024, with a home game against the Freedom Patriots. The Warriors beat the Patriots 22-3. “I feel we’re having a pretty solid season so far; we’ve had some close games against some big teams that could’ve gone both ways, we just have to keep working to get better as a team and keep working towards our goal of a regional championship.” said Senior, Damien Clements. Following that game the Warriors played 4 consecutive away games against Cardinal Mooney on February 15th, Newsome on February 19th,  Robinson on February 27th, and Jesuit on February 28th, going 1-3 in those games. The one win being a 18-0 shutout win against Robinson. “Though Shale is gone (to injury), many players have been able to step up. Both in a skill point of view and as a leader.” said Junior, Calvin Wright.  

The Warriors played consecutive home games against Sickles that ended in a 13-12 win in double overtime, and a 19-3 win against Alonso. The Steinbrenner played their final game before a break against a tough Winter Park team. They would fall short 9-6. “Although in the teams toughest tests so far, against the likes of Jesuit, Cardinal Mooney, Newsome, & Winter Park, we have come up short, we have shown grit and determination to respond to the challenge of playing some of the top teams in not only the area but the state as well; not in terms of results but in character and performance” said Head Coach Jeremy Kuebrich. The Steinbrenner Warriors returned from break against the Plant Panthers, they took a loss of 9-8, but look to move in the right direction the rest of the way.
